Transaction 6667d35e54893c851260d378e1b44a47c1b7e20e5ee15cfec018cb99d8d73d39

2 Input
2 Outputs
  • 6667d35e54893c851260d378e1b44a47c1b7e20e5ee15cfec018cb99d8d73d39:0
  • value  16944
    address  1Q6wzyy5FXzjx1gCTeHv5YmkZAiBkimB4k
  • 6667d35e54893c851260d378e1b44a47c1b7e20e5ee15cfec018cb99d8d73d39:1
  • value  2805008
    address  1rHycQb67goXPDHwz8XmU4DKXkgM69Q1a